MRM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2022 in Review
1 of the 5,936 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in MEDIROM Healthcare Technologies (MRM) for Q2 2022, worth a combined $13K — down 89% from $116K a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 3 funds closed out of MRM and 0 opened new positions — a net loss of 3 holders — while 1 trimmed existing stakes and 0 added.
The largest seller was UBS Group, cutting an estimated $69.5K.
